Janus Henderson Group PLC trimmed its position in shares of Danaher Corporation (NYSE:DHR – Free Report) by 4.8% during the first quarter, Holdings Channel.com reports. The firm owned 6,489,965 shares of the conglomerate’s stock after selling 327,641 shares during the period. Danaher accounts for 0.6% of Janus Henderson Group PLC’s holdings, making the stock its 27th biggest position. Janus Henderson Group PLC’s holdings in Danaher were worth $1,222,064,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

About Danaher
Danaher Corporation (NYSE: DHR) is a global science and technology company that designs, manufactures and markets products and services for the life sciences, diagnostics, and environmental and applied markets. The company organizes its operations into business segments focused on Life Sciences, Diagnostics, and Environmental & Applied Solutions, supplying instruments, reagents, software and related services that support research, clinical testing, biopharmaceutical development, and industrial and environmental monitoring.
Products and services in Danaher’s portfolio include analytical and diagnostic instruments, laboratory consumables and reagents, digital and software solutions for workflow and data management, field and industrial monitoring equipment, and service and maintenance programs.
